搭建Django模塊的一般步驟如下:
創建Django項目:使用django-admin startproject
命令創建一個新的Django項目。例如,運行django-admin startproject myproject
創建一個名為“myproject”的新項目。
創建Django應用:應用是Django項目中的可重用模塊。使用python manage.py startapp
命令創建一個新的Django應用。例如,運行python manage.py startapp myapp
創建一個名為“myapp”的新應用。
配置應用:在Django項目中,編輯項目的settings.py
文件,將新創建的應用添加到INSTALLED_APPS
列表中。例如,將'myapp'
添加到INSTALLED_APPS
列表中。
創建模型:在新創建的應用中,編輯models.py
文件,定義模型類。模型類定義了應用程序的數據結構。例如,創建一個名為MyModel
的模型類。
遷移數據庫:運行python manage.py makemigrations
命令,生成數據庫遷移文件,該文件描述了模型類的更改。然后運行python manage.py migrate
命令,將數據庫遷移到最新的狀態。
創建視圖:在應用的views.py
文件中定義視圖函數,用于處理請求并返回響應。例如,創建一個名為my_view
的視圖函數。
創建URL配置:在應用的urls.py
文件中定義URL路由和視圖函數的映射關系。例如,將my_view
視圖函數映射到URL路徑/myview/
。
運行開發服務器:運行python manage.py runserver
命令啟動Django開發服務器,以便在瀏覽器中查看和測試應用程序。
通過以上步驟,您可以使用Django框架創建和搭建模塊化的應用程序。根據具體需求,可以進一步擴展和定制您的Django應用。